A framed embroidered silk vestment panel, likely French and dating from the late 18th to early 19th century. The fragment presents a refined symmetrical composition worked in a harmonious and subtle palette of soft gold, muted green, pale blue, and rose set against a light silk ground. The delicate hand embroidery displays remarkable finesse, its intricate floral sprays and repeating baskets stitched with a lightness that gives the surface both richness and quiet charm.
At the upper center appears the Sacred Heart beneath radiating rays and a small cross, forming the devotional focal point of the design. The motif is framed by finely embroidered foliage and floral garlands arranged along a central axis forming a cross, creating a balanced and graceful composition typical of ecclesiastical textiles of the period.
Now mounted and framed against a muted textile ground, the piece can be appreciated both as a fragment of religious history and as a work of textile artistry.
